edge computing enhances high resolution streaming

Streaming technology is rapidly evolving, shaping how we consume media and interact online. One of the most exciting developments is the integration of edge computing, which brings processing power closer to your device. Instead of relying solely on distant data centers, edge computing allows data to be processed locally, reducing latency and improving real-time experiences. Imagine streaming a high-quality virtual reality (VR) game or a live sports event without annoying lag or buffering—this is what edge computing enables. With faster data processing at the edge, VR applications become more immersive and responsive, making you feel like you’re truly part of the action. This shift not only enhances entertainment but also benefits fields like remote work, telemedicine, and education, where instant data exchange is vital. As streaming services push the boundaries of visual quality, 8K resolution is emerging as the new standard for ultra-high-definition content. When you watch an 8K stream, you’ll notice incredibly sharp details, vibrant colors, and a level of clarity that surpasses 4K or even standard HD. This leap in resolution is made possible by advancements in compression algorithms and increased bandwidth capabilities, ensuring more data can be transmitted efficiently. The rise of 8K content is also driving hardware improvements, from better screens to more powerful processors that can handle the massive data loads. You’re likely to see 8K streaming become mainstream as content creators and providers recognize the demand for cinema-quality visuals at home. This trend is especially significant for large screens and immersive environments like VR, where high resolution enhances realism and engagement. AI recommendations are transforming the way you discover content. Streaming platforms now leverage sophisticated algorithms that analyze your viewing habits, preferences, and even your emotional responses to suggest movies, shows, or music you’re most likely to enjoy. These AI systems learn from your interactions, continuously refining their recommendations to make them more personalized. The goal is to create a seamless experience where you spend less time searching and more time enjoying content tailored precisely to your tastes. As AI continues to evolve, it’ll incorporate more contextual data—like your location, current mood, or social trends—to enhance suggestions further. What Are the Challenges of Adopting 8K Streaming Widely?

Imagine you’re trying to stream a high-quality 8K video, but face bandwidth hurdles that cause buffering. Widespread adoption struggles because of limited infrastructure and high costs. Content scarcity also poses a challenge, as few creators produce content in 8K yet. These issues make it difficult for consumers to access consistent, high-quality experiences, slowing down the shift from traditional HD to 8K streaming on a broad scale.

How Does AI Improve Buffering and Streaming Stability?

AI improves buffering and streaming stability through buffer optimization and bandwidth management. You benefit from smarter algorithms that predict your viewing patterns, reducing interruptions. AI dynamically adjusts streaming quality based on your internet speed, preventing buffering delays. It also manages bandwidth usage efficiently, ensuring smooth playback even during peak times. By constantly optimizing these factors, AI delivers a seamless streaming experience, so you can enjoy your content without frustrating interruptions.
